Failure to satisfy fines or penalties; referral to Secretary of State.

(a)In addition to any other remedies provided by law, the Commission may report any person with unpaid fees, fines, or penalties issued by the Commission to the Secretary of State for suspension of the person's tow truck registrations.
(b)Prior to referral under this Section, the Commission shall issue a final demand for payment which shall clearly state that failure to pay the outstanding fines or penalties by the date provided in the demand will result in a referral to the Secretary of State for the suspension of that person's tow truck registrations in accordance with Section 3-704.4.
